The last threat area where doctor lenders can definitely become undone happens when a health care professional is certainly going to your individual routine, joining a group because somebody, or delivering the right position as the another contractor receiving 1099 money (we see that it much having anesthesiologists and you may disaster drug medical professionals). Medical practitioner mortgage loans, additionally, will generally allow degree just after no to 6 months towards the occupations, depending on the details of the use bargain and practice plan.

Antique and you may FHA fund, that produce upwards 95 percent of the mortgages about entire nation, want a-two-12 months reputation of self-a career otherwise 1099 separate company taxation before you to definitely earnings is going to be regularly qualify for a home loan
